Always have Correct Change in your wallet: "So what is the fewest number of coins you can carry that allows you to produce any exact change? The answer is 10 coins: 3 quarters, 1 dime, 2 nickels, and 4 pennies. With this combination you can produce any number between 1-99 cents. An alternative answer would be 6 coins: 3 quarters, 2 dimes and 1 nickel. In this example you will range most change between 5-95 cents, in 5 cents increments. In this example you will never receive more than 4 cents in change back."
